WebMar 25, 2024 · Gastric volvulus (GV) is a rare cause of partial or total foregut obstruction in paediatric age. This potentially life-threatening condition is characterised by a twisting of the stomach more than 180° on its longitudinal or transversal axis with probable gastric ischemia and perforation. WebThis section of liver is from a jaundiced 4 month old girl with foregut situs inversus and foregut malrotation. Nodules of hepatic parenchyma are surrounded by chronic inflammation and fibrosis. After prolonged obstruction, there is reactive bile duct proliferation. Periportal fibrosis is induced.
